Question 2: In Melodyne, what is a 'blob'?
- A visual representation of a single detected note or audio event (Correct answer)
- A type of reverb tail
- A compressor sidechain signal
- A MIDI CC automation node
Correct answer: A visual representation of a single detected note or audio event
Blobs in Melodyne are the visual note objects that represent detected pitches and can be moved, stretched, and adjusted.
Question 3: What advantage does polyphonic pitch correction (e.g., Melodyne 5 Polyphonic) offer over standard monophonic correction?
- It can correct individual notes within chords or layered harmonies (Correct answer)
- It only works on single lead vocals
- It removes all reverb from recordings
- It converts audio to MIDI automatically
Correct answer: It can correct individual notes within chords or layered harmonies
Polyphonic correction analyses multiple simultaneous pitches and can adjust individual notes within chords or stacked vocal layers.
Question 4: What does the 'Scale Detune' feature do in Auto-Tune?
- Adjusts the reference pitch of the target scale away from A440 (Correct answer)
- Removes background noise from the vocal
- Increases the stereo width of the correction
- Adds chorus to the tuned signal
Correct answer: Adjusts the reference pitch of the target scale away from A440
Scale Detune shifts the entire target scale up or down in cents so vocalists working in alternate tunings are corrected to the right pitch.

Question 6: What is 'pitch drift' in a vocal performance?
- A gradual movement away from the intended pitch over the duration of a note (Correct answer)
- A sudden jump between two notes
- Intentional glissando between pitches
- The attack transient of a consonant
Correct answer: A gradual movement away from the intended pitch over the duration of a note
Pitch drift occurs when a singer slowly slides off-key during a sustained note, often requiring correction in the middle of the note rather than at its start.
